Ingredients

For the Dressing

  • 1 cup of mayo
  • 2 TBSP of apple cider vinegar
  • 1/2 tsp of salt
  • 1 tsp of dried oregano
  • 1 tsp of Italian seasoning
  • 1 tsp of gar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p of red pepper flakes

For the Salad

  • 1/3 cup pepperoncinis peppers, drained
  • 1/3 cup of shredded Par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 of a red onion, chopped
  • 19 oz frozen cheese tortellini
  • 8 slices of bacon, cooked and chopped (substitute with turkey bacon if preferred)
  • 1 heaping cup grape tomatoes, sliced

How to Make Grinder Salad Tortellini Pasta Salad

Step 1: Cook the Tortellini

  1. Boil water in a pot according to package instructions.
  2. Add the frozen cheese tortellini and cook until tender.
  3. Drain the tortellini using a colander and rinse under cold water to stop cooking.

Step 2: Prepare the Dressing

  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ine the mayo, apple cider vinegar, salt, dried oregano,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, and red pepper flakes.
  2. Stir well until all ingredients are thoroughly mixed.

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

  1. To the dressing, add the cooked tortellini, drained pepperoncinis peppers, shredded Parmesan cheese, chopped red onion, sliced tomatoes, and chopped bacon (or turkey bacon).
  2. Gently fold all ingredients together until well coated with dressing.

Step 4: Chill and Serve

  1. Cover the salad with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container.
  2. Refrigerate for at least one hour to allow flavors to meld.
  3. Serve chilled as a delightful side dish at your next gathering! Enjoy!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When making Grinder Salad Tortellini Pasta Salad, it’s easy to overlook a few key details. Here are some common mistakes to avoid:

  • Skipping the Chill Time – Not letting the salad sit in the refrigerator can lead to a bland flavor. Chill for at least an hour to enhance the taste.
  • Overcooking the Tortellini – Cooking tortellini too long can make it mushy. Follow package instructions closely for the best texture.
  • Ignoring Ingredient Ratios – Using too much mayo or vinegar can overpower other flavors. Stick to the recipe for balanced taste.
  • Forgetting to Drain Ingredients – Not draining pepperoncinis or rinsing tortellini can introduce extra moisture. Always drain and rinse as directed.

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some common inquiries regarding Grinder Salad Tortellini Pasta Salad:

Can I use fresh tortellini instead of frozen?

Yes! Fresh tortellini may have a different cooking time, so adjust accordingly.

What can I substitute for mayonnaise?

You can use Greek yogurt or an avocado-based dressing for a lighter option in your Grinder Salad Tortellini Pasta Salad.

How can I customize my pasta salad?

Add your favorite vegetables like bell peppers or cucumbers, or even swap out the cheese for something different.

How long will this pasta salad last?

The Grinder Salad Tortellini Pasta Salad will typically last up to 3 days when stored properly in the refrigerator.

Can I make this pasta salad ahead of time?

Absolutely! Making it a day before serving allows flavors to meld beautifully.
